200 BCE-1200 CE
This is a truncated biconical weight. Two stamped concentric circles decorate one face, and may have decorated the other face as well, although it is now too worn to distinguish. There does seem to be the hint of a depression, however, on that worn face. The weight has a green patina with a tan coating.
0.6 x 1.6 x 1.6 cm (1/4 x 5/8 x 5/8 in.) 8.15 g
